From LGBT Archive
Jump to: navigation, search

TWO86 or Two8six is a gay bar in Lewisham, South London, formerly known as Stonewalls, and originally as The Castle Inn.

In October 2012 local residents were reported to be fighting to keep it open after a property firm had sent in the bailiffs and changed the locks. Stephen Thompson, the former licensee, said:

This pub has been closed, not because it isn’t profitable, but because an offshore property developer with no connection or concern for Lewisham, wants to make money out of the land value of the pub and placed unreasonable demands on my business including raising the rent from £38k to £60k.[1]

External links


  1. Pink News 1 November 2012